What does a Occupational Therapist Do?

Occupational therapists support children in building everyday skills—so they can grow, play, and be more independent. If your child struggles with things like getting dressed, using utensils, paying attention, or staying calm in new situations, an OT can help.

OTs focus on:

Fine motor skills – like holding a pencil, buttoning a shirt, or using scissors 

Sensory processing – supporting kids who are extra sensitive to sounds, textures, or movement (or don’t seem to notice them at all)

Emotional regulation – helping kids manage big feelings and focus at school or home 

Independence and daily skills – like brushing teeth, tying shoes, potty training, or washing hands.

Occupational therapy supports kids at home, at school, and in everyday life—so they can feel confident and capable in the things they do every day.
